首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

以www-data身份运行crontab,以所有者身份创建www-data文件

www-data是一个在Linux系统中用于运行Web服务器的用户身份。它是一个非特权用户,具有较低的权限,用于提供对Web服务器文件和目录的访问。

在Linux系统中,crontab是一个用于定时执行任务的工具。通过使用crontab,可以在指定的时间间隔内自动运行脚本或命令。在这种情况下,以www-data身份运行crontab意味着使用www-data用户身份来执行定时任务。

当以www-data身份运行crontab时,可以使用以下命令来创建一个以所有者身份为www-data用户创建文件的脚本:

代码语言:txt
复制
sudo -u www-data touch /path/to/file

上述命令中,sudo -u www-data表示以www-data用户身份执行后续的命令,touch /path/to/file用于创建一个空文件。

这种方式的应用场景包括需要在定时任务中以www-data用户身份创建文件的情况,例如在Web应用程序中生成临时文件或日志文件。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云产品的详细信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Win10 开启管理员身份运行

    ✍01 鼠标右击点击管理员身份运行 ✪ Chrome 浏览器快捷方式举例: ? 鼠标右击管理员身份运行 ✍02 win + s 开启电脑搜索 win + s 快捷键开启电脑搜索,输入相关程序。...win + s 管理员身份运行cmd ✍03 快捷方式属性[兼容性设置] 前两种方式每次打开程序时都要进行相关操作才能以管理员身份运行,不能一劳永逸。...快捷方式管理员身份运行 以后只要鼠标双击打开程序就是以管理员身份运行次程序。 ✍04 运行管理员权限创建此任务 有时我们运行命令也需要以管理员运行,才能执行更多的操作。...✪ cmd命令提示符举例: ctrl + shift + esc 快捷键开启任务管理器选择 文件 点击 运行新任务 ?...任务管理器运行新任务 弹出新建任务窗口,输入cmd,勾选系统管理权限创建此任务 ? 资源管理器新建任务 ✪ cmd命令提示符对比: 普通的cmd命令提示符与管理员的cmd命令提示符区别对比图 ?

    3.7K10

    Win10 开启管理员身份运行

    ✍ 前言: 你们遇到过打开程序提示权限不足,权限错误,无法加载xxx,尤其是用编程语言控制电脑运行。 或者是执行一些命令时需要以管理员权限才执行。本文介绍多种形式开启管理员身份运行。...✍01 鼠标右击点击管理员身份运行(A) ✪ Chrome 浏览器快捷方式举例: ✍02 win + s 开启电脑搜索 win + s 快捷键开启电脑搜索,输入相关程序。...鼠标右击程序快捷方式点击属性然后选择兼容性选项,勾选管理员身份运行此程序。 ✪ Chrome 浏览器快捷方式举例: ​ 以后只要鼠标双击打开程序就是以管理员身份运行次程序。...✍04 运行指令管理员权限创建此任务 有时我们运行命令也需要以管理员运行,才能执行更多的操作。...✪ cmd命令提示符举例: ctrl + shift + esc 快捷键开启任务管理器选择 文件 点击 运行新任务 弹出新建任务窗口,输入cmd,勾选系统管理权限创建此任务 资源管理器新建任务

    3.5K10

    如何让Delphi程序启动自动“管理员身份运行

    由于Vista以后win中加入的UAC安全机制,采用Delphi开发的程序如果不右键点击“管理员身份运行”,则会报错。...右建点击工程,选择“Options”->“Applicaion”下,将Runtime themes项设置为“Use Custom manifest”,点击下方按钮,选择相应的Manifest文件即可。...,名称为uac.rc 如下所示: 1 24 UAC.manifest 其中: 1-代表资源编号 24-资源类型为RTMAINIFEST UAC.manifest-前面的文件名称 用brcc32编译这个...rc文件为res文件,如下所示: brcc32 uac.rc -fouac.res 在程序里面加入 {$R uac.res} 让Delphi编译的时候,把uac.res编译进exe文件文件放到...vista或win7下运行,就会看程序图标下面显示UAC盾牌标志了。

    2.4K20

    Sudo漏洞允许非特权Linux和macOS用户root身份运行命令

    苹果安全团队成员Joe Vennix发现了sudo实用程序中的一个重要漏洞,即在特定配置下,它可能允许低特权用户或恶意程序在Linux或macOS系统上 root身份执行命令。 ?...Sudo给了用户不同身份的特权来运行应用程序或命令,而无需切换运行环境。...根据Vennix的说法,只有在sudoers配置文件中启用了“pwfeedback ”选项时,攻击者才能利用该漏洞。当用户在终端中输入密码时,攻击者可以看到该文件提供的反馈,星号(*)标注。...除此之外,启用pwfeedback时,即使没有sudo权限,任何用户都可以利用此漏洞运行命令。...Joe Vennix在去年10月报告了sudo中的类似漏洞,攻击者只要通过指定用户ID“ -1”或“4294967295”就可以利用该漏洞root身份运行命令。

    2.2K10

    Runas命令能让域用户普通User用户管理员身份运行指定程序

    比如:某些特定的部门(如财务,物流)没有管理员权限,但工作又需要使用特定的插件或程序,且该程序或插件又必须管理员身份运行,在这种情况下,我们如果将用户的权限提升为管理员,那样会增加安全风险而且可能引起很多不可控的情况...echo off runas /user:Colin-PC\Administrator /sa “C:\Program Files\Internet Explorer\iexplore.exe” 说明:管理员身份运行...向这样,我们将命令保存为批处理后,只要在用户电脑上运行这个批处理(第一次输入管理员密码),以后用户只要双击该文件就可会管理员身份执行命令中所指定的程序了。 ————————- 这样就完了吗?...如果用户是稍稍有点电脑基础,他就会知道批处理怎样编辑,只要他将指定的程序路径改为他想要以管理员身份运行的程序就可以执行,那岂不是可以为所欲为了? 所以,确定批处理正确无误后,我们应该进行封装操作。...封装为.exe的程序后如下图: 这样,我们只要将该exe文件放在D:\Program Files目录下,然后再创建一个快捷方式到桌面,这样,用户下次就可以很方便的使用了。

    5.2K00

    如何在Debian 8上发布Booktype书籍

    您需要重新输入进行确认。 注意:在安全的地方记下密码。您将在步骤5 - 创建书型实例中再次使用它。 然后创建一个名为booktype-db的数据库,设置booktype-user为所有者。...为Booktype实例创建一个目录,例如/var/www/booktype/: sudo mkdir /var/www/booktype/ 确保它由运行Web服务器的www-data用户拥有: sudo...您将需要编辑/etc/passwd的文件中的行www-data继续: sudo nano /etc/passwd 用/bin/bash更换/usr/sbin/nologin的www-data用户,如下所示...现在切换到www-data开始创建Booktype实例: sudo su www-data 使用dev配置文件和/var/www/booktype/instance1目录中的postgresql数据库创建第一个...使用以下命令返回终端中正常的非root sudo用户提示符: exit 您不再以www-data用户身份输入命令。

    1K00

    Linux下suid提权利用

    设置了s位的程序在运行时,其Effective UID将会设置为这个程序的所有者。...比如,/bin/ping这个程序的所有者是0(root),它设置了s位,那么普通用户在运行ping时其Effective UID就是0,等同于拥有了root权限。...    通常情况下Effective UID和Real UID相等,所以普通用户不能写入只有UID=0号才可写的/etc/passwd;有suid的程序启动时,Effective UID就等于二进制文件所有者...所以,可以看出,Ubuntu发行版官方对dash进行了修改:当dashsuid权限运行、且没有指定-p选项时,将会丢弃suid权限,恢复当前用户权限。...Oct 5 22:34 /bin/ping$ getcap /bin/ping/bin/ping = cap_net_raw+ep 这就是为什么kali的ping命令无需设置setuid权限,却仍然可以普通用户身份运行的原因

    2.5K30

    谈一谈Linux与suid提权

    设置了s位的程序在运行时,其Effective UID将会设置为这个程序的所有者。...比如,/bin/ping这个程序的所有者是0(root),它设置了s位,那么普通用户在运行ping时其Effective UID就是0,等同于拥有了root权限。...进行深入探讨) 通常情况下Effective UID和Real UID相等,所以普通用户不能写入只有UID=0号才可写的/etc/passwd;有suid的程序启动时,Effective UID就等于二进制文件所有者...所以,可以看出,Ubuntu发行版官方对dash进行了修改:当dashsuid权限运行、且没有指定-p选项时,将会丢弃suid权限,恢复当前用户权限。...5 22:34 /bin/ping $ getcap /bin/ping /bin/ping = cap_net_raw+ep 这就是为什么kali的ping命令无需设置setuid权限,却仍然可以普通用户身份运行的原因

    1.8K20

    利用Nginx本地文件包含 (LFI) 漏洞的新方法

    大多数当前的 LFI 开发技术依赖于 PHP 能够创建某种形式的临时或会话文件。让我们考虑以下示例,其中以前可用的技巧不起作用: PHP代码: <?...Nginx 提供了一个容易被忽视的客户端主体缓冲功能,如果客户端主体(不限于发布)大于某个阈值,它将写入临时文件。...如果 Nginx 与 PHP 相同的用户身份运行(通常以 www-data身份运行),则此功能允许在不使用任何其他创建文件的方式的情况下利用 LFI。...幸运的是 procfs 仍可用于通过竞争获取对已删除文件的引用: ......通过fastcgi_buffering它更容易利用,因为可以通过调用readfilehttp:// 资源保持临时文件打开。

    1.3K20
    领券